Clearing Unnecessary Files and Cache on Your Mac to Increase Speed

We all want our Macs to run as fast as possible, right? But sometimes it feels like they slow down over time, and we’re left frustrated with the spinning rainbow cursor. Well, fear not! There’s a simple solution to this problem: clearing unnecessary files and cache.

First things first – let’s talk about cache. **Cache** is like a temporary storage space on your Mac that stores data from websites and applications you frequently visit or use. It helps speed up loading times by storing information locally, so your computer doesn’t have to fetch it from the internet every single time. However, over time, this cache can accumulate unwanted data and take up valuable space on your hard drive.

To clear the cache on your Mac, follow these steps:
1. Open Finder.
2. Click “Go” in the menu bar at the top of your screen.
3. Press and hold down the Option key (⌄).
4. You’ll see a new option called “Library” – click on it.
5. Within Library folder, locate and open “Caches.”
6. Select all folders inside “Caches” folder by pressing Command + A.
7. Move everything to Trash by dragging them or using Command + Delete.

Optimizing Settings and Applications to Boost Your MacBook Pro’s Speed

When it comes to optimizing your MacBook Pro’s speed, there are a few settings and applications that can work wonders. Let’s dive into the nitty-gritty of how you can make your beloved device lightning-fast!

First things first, let’s talk about tweaking some settings. One simple yet effective trick is to manage your startup items. When you power on your MacBook Pro, numerous apps automatically launch in the background, hogging precious memory and slowing down its overall performance. To tackle this issue head-on, navigate to “System Preferences” and click on “Users & Groups.” From there, select your username and then go to the “Login Items” tab. Here lies a list of all the startup apps – simply uncheck those that you don’t need immediately upon booting up.

Now let’s move on to applications that will turbocharge your MacBook Pro! CleanMyMac X is like a magical broomstick for sweeping away unnecessary clutter from your system. It not only clears caches but also trashes outdated files with surgical precision – giving an instant boost to both speed and storage capacity.

Another game-changer in terms of boosting speed is App Tamer. This powerful tool prevents resource-hungry applications from consuming excessive CPU power when they’re running in the background or idle for too long without being used actively. With App Tamer keeping these misbehaving apps in check, you’ll notice a significant improvement in multitasking abilities without sacrificing any functionality.
